Conflict management techniques include changing organizational structures to avoid built-in conflict, changing team members, creating a common “enemy,” using majority rules, and problem solving. Conflict management styles include accommodating others, avoiding the conflict, collaborating, competing, and compromising.
Web14 mei 2024 · Conflict management is a strategy used to identify and handle disagreements between two parties. Employers can use conflict management to resolve minor disputes, as well as more important issues. A properly managed conflict can minimise the negative consequences that surround disputes at work.
